About the course

This Certificate I introduces routine, predictable tourism work tasks completed under close supervision. It is designed for roles in tourism organisations with an Australian Indigenous focus, such as tour operators and cultural or heritage centres, including approved community members who share culture with visitors. Training is delivered face-to-face in block delivery arrangements and aligns with relevant legislation, standards and industry codes for a Certificate I in Hospitality & Tourism.

Career outcome

Graduates may support tourism and cultural visitor experiences in organisations with an Australian Indigenous focus. The course can lead to entry-level assistant roles in cultural or heritage settings, helping with guided activities and sharing stories under direction. Typical opportunities include assistant in an Indigenous cultural centre, assistant Indigenous guide, and Indigenous storyteller, suited to a Certificate I pathway in Hospitality & Tourism.
